Statement on the coverage by the Süddeutsche Zeitung on November 9, 2023: Nele Pollatschek "Not again, Documenta"

In yesterday's article in the Süddeutsche Zeitung Nicht schon wieder, Documenta (Not again, Documenta), Nele Pollatschek reports that a statement considered closely affiliated with the BDS movement was signed by member of the documenta 16 Finding Committee Ranjit Hoskoté. This was the "Statement against consulate general of Israel, Mumbai's event on Hindutva and Zionism" dated August 26, 2019.

Commenting on this matter Andreas Hoffmann said the following: "The signing of the above statement by a member of the Finding Committee of the Artistic Direction of documenta 16 is not in the least acceptable to us at documenta und Museum Fridericianum gGmbH due to its explicitly anti-Semitic content. We were not aware of Ranjit Hoskoté's signature under the statement from 2019 until yesterday. Likewise, we were not even aware of the statement itself.

Addressing the anti-Semitic misconduct at documenta 15 is a very serious matter for us: It was an essential requirement of the shareholders that the Finding Committee should have no BDS affiliations, and this was explicitly conveyed to the former Artistic Directors entrusted with the task of setting up the Finding Committee (see Statement of the former Artistic Directors of documenta on the proposal for the appointment of the documenta 16 finding committee).

Before taking up their committee work all six members of the Finding Committee made an unambiguous declaration to documenta und Museum Fridericianum gGmbH and explicitly distanced themselves from the BDS movement."

Following the press report in the Süddeutsche Zeitung, Ranjit Hoskoté stated to documenta und Museum Fridericianum gGmbH that by signing the declaration in 2019, he had particularly opposed Hindutva extremism, which is avowedly inspired by Nazism and fascism. He had dedicated his life to rejecting authoritarian ideologies. Meanwhile, he has spoken out publicly and clearly against any cultural boycott of Israel. He rejects the goals of the BDS movement and does not support the movement. In particular after October 7, 2023, following Hamas' terror in Israel and its consequences, his thoughts are with both the Jewish and the Palestinian people, with the suffering civilian population in Israel and Palestine.

This statement made to documenta und Museum Fridericianum gGmbH gives us reason to discuss more extensive questions with the member of the Finding Committee.
